Rookie Profile: Will Shipley, Running Back, Philadelphia Eagles


Welcome to the Rookie Profile: Will Shipley, a 5-star prospect from Weddington, North Carolina. He was so good in high school that he committed to Clemson University in his junior season. Without playing his season season due to Covid scheduling issues, Shipley ended his career at Weddington High School with over 5500 combined rushing and receiving yards and 80 touchdowns.

While starting just 5 games in his freshman year at Clemson, Shipley showed promise. He broke out in his sophomore campaign, with 1182 yards rushing and 15 rushing touchdowns, adding 248 yards receiving on 38 receptions.

Unfortunately for Shipley, running mate Phil Mafah came on last year, splitting rushing duties, dominating goal line work, and earning a share of receiving duties as well. When all was said and done, Shipley ended his final collegiate season with just 1071 total yards and only 7 touchdowns.

Draft Capital & Landing Spot

Draft Capital- Round 4, Pick 27

  • Shipley was drafted as the 7th running back off the board. That’s significant, even in a weaker-than-normal RB draft class.
  • Shipley fell in between Bucky Irving and Ray Davis early in Day 3, but it speaks to his upside given how we view those players. He gained some slight value now that we see how the NFL views him.

Landing Spot- Philadelphia Eagles

  • Outside of stud free agent acquisition Saquon Barkley, there’s plenty of space in Philly to flourish as a depth piece early on. Barkley has had his struggles with injury, so Shipley could carve out a complementary role early alongside Kenneth Gainwell as a passing-down specialist and the potential #2 back.
  • In a high-powered offense, it’s interesting to consider one of the best pure pass catchers at the position potentially being utilized like a #3 wide receiver. If Ainias Smith or Harris Campbell don’t step up immediately, Shipley could work in the slot more than we expect.

Fantasy Impact

Shipley has multiple avenues to immediate playing time given the expectations of his draft capital and the subpar play of some of the presumed guys ahead of him on both the running back and wide receiver depth charts in Philadelphia. If he can prove an asset in making Kellen Moore install more multiple, he could become a valuable depth piece for fantasy squads.

I like Shipley as a ppr specialist who can work into starting fantasy lineups in certain matchups, with the potential for a larger role if there is an injury ahead of him. As a 3rd round rookie pick or a super late-round flyer in dynasty startups and redraft leagues, you could do a lot worse.
